Remaking a beloved movie or TV show is never easy. When the franchise being remade is as big as Harry Potter, then getting fans on side is almost an impossible task. Even ignoring the constant noise about author J.K. Rowling, there are many who see HBO Max’s upcoming Harry Potter TV show a pointless exercise in money-grabbing from Warner Bros. However, recent footage of filming on the show has been getting an increasingly positive response from fans, despite it involving a character whose recast is one of several that comes with the burden of taking over a role from an actor no longer with us. Several stars of the original Harry Potter movies have sadly passed away in the years since they turned Rowling’s cast of wizards, witches and muggles into legends of cinema. Dame Maggie Smith, Alan Rickman, both Richard Harris and Michael Gambon, who play the role of Albus Dumbledore across the franchise, and Robbie Coltrane are the most notable. In the case of the latter, playing Hogwarts gamekeeper Rubeus Hagrid endeared Coltrane to a much younger audience than many of his other roles, and now comedy actor Nick Frost is stepping into the very large shoes of the gentle giant. And as more footage of him on set appeared online, along with his body double filming with new Harry Potter, Dominic McLaughlin, fans have been getting more and more behind the casting and the series.

Today, more stars were added to the growing cast of HBO’s Harry Potter series, with several members of the Weasley family being announced. However, these castings were really a moot point for many, as despite the roles of Ginny, George, Fred, and Percy Weasley are prominent throughout the story, their original actors were only children when cast two decades ago and, for some reason, that doesn’t hold quite the same romantic air as the adult stars of the movies. Nick Frost’s casting as Hagrid was generally well received, with the obvious grumbles of “cosplay Hagrid” and such like in various comments. However, the casting of American John Lithgow as Dumbledore (“How dare they cast an American? It should have been someone British!”) and Black actor Paapa Essiedu as Severus Snape (who was even still receiving complaints in comments on the new set footage not featuring the character) were two big bugbears among the casting announcements made so far. In the end, though, the Harry Potter TV show is happening. New actors will be playing the characters that a whole generation grew up with, and – regardless of threats otherwise – the series will be one of the biggest original shows to ever hit HBO and HBO Max because that is just how things work.
